> > On 3/13/06, Deanna Schneider <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ote:
> > > It _is_ very soft and feminine - which isn't necessarily a bad thing if
> > > you're wanting to attract the crowd that's afraid of technology.
> > >
> > > The links in the top right are too squished - they need some space above 
> > > and
> > > below each line. Also, I wouldn't include a beta lab in a marketing site.
> > > I'm assuming this is a marketing site. A beta lab is great for a technical
> > > audience - but your run of the mill customers aren't going to know what it
> > > is. So, the beta lab idea contradicts the soft approach. Which way are you
> > > trying to go?
